Understanding Nulled Software

Nulled software refers to a version of a program or application that has been altered or "cracked" to bypass licensing restrictions. This is typically done to allow users to access premium features without paying for them. The term "nulled" comes from the practice of setting a software's license or activation checks to null, effectively nullifying the need for a legitimate license key.

The world of nulled software is vast and complex, with numerous websites and forums dedicated to sharing and discussing cracked versions of popular applications. Proponents of nulled software often argue that it provides access to essential tools for those who cannot afford them, while critics point out the significant risks and downsides, including security vulnerabilities, malware infections, and legal repercussions.

The search term "Zal Pro Nulled Exclusive" refers to an unauthorised, "cracked" version of Zal Pro, a specialized ISP CRM (Customer Relationship Management) and billing software developed by Onezeroart LLC.

While "nulled" versions are often marketed as free or "exclusive" ways to access premium features, they carry significant risks that can compromise an entire business operation. What is Zal Pro?

Zal Pro is a comprehensive software suite designed for Internet Service Providers (ISPs) to manage bandwidth, billing, and customer relations. Its legitimate features include:

Bandwidth Management: Supports Radius AAA (Authentication, Authorization, and Accounting) and MikroTik API integration for real-time user monitoring.

Automated Billing: Provides automated invoicing, recurring billing, and integration with multiple payment gateways like PayPal, Stripe, and bKash.

Multi-Tier Reselling: Allows ISPs to manage unlimited franchises, dealers, and sub-dealers with independent panels and profit management.

Customer Support Tools: Includes a built-in ticketing system, SMS notifications, and a self-service client portal. The "Nulled Exclusive" Trap

Websites offering a "nulled exclusive" version of Zal Pro claim to have removed the license verification (nulling), allowing the software to run without a paid subscription. However, using such software poses these critical dangers:

Malware and Backdoors: Nulled scripts are frequently modified to include hidden malware or backdoors. This gives hackers unauthorized access to your server, allowing them to steal sensitive customer data or shut down your ISP services entirely.

Data Theft: Because Zal Pro handles customer personal info and billing details, a nulled version can leak usernames, passwords, and payment logs to third parties.

Lack of Updates and Support: ISPs require high uptime and security patches. Nulled versions do not receive official updates, leaving your network vulnerable to new exploits. You also lose access to the 24/7 technical support provided by the developer.

Legal Consequences: Distributing or using nulled software is a violation of copyright laws. It can lead to hefty fines or legal action from developers and may cause your hosting provider to suspend your account. Legitimate Alternatives

For small or starting ISPs, there are safer ways to access Zal Pro:

Trial Version: The developer often offers a free trial version that supports up to 500 subscribers, allowing you to test all features legally.

Tiered Pricing: Official licenses start at approximately ~$99 for 500 users, providing a scalable path for growth without the risks of pirated software.

Zal Pro is a specialized Customer Relationship Management (CRM) and billing software designed for Internet Service Providers (ISPs). It is widely used by small to mid-sized ISPs to manage their networks, subscribers, and financial operations from a centralized platform.

The phrase "Zal Pro Nulled Exclusive" refers to unauthorized, pirated versions of the software that have been modified to bypass license verification. Key Features of Zal Pro

The official software, such as the Zal Pro ISP CRM, provides a suite of tools for ISP management:

Radius AAA Server Support: Handles authentication, authorization, and accounting for network users.

MikroTik API Integration: Allows for seamless management of MikroTik NAS devices, including bandwidth control and user disconnection.

Real-Time Monitoring: Includes live bandwidth usage graphs and online user tracking.

Billing & Accounting: Features automated invoicing, a hierarchical reseller system (Admin → Reseller → Sub-reseller), and multiple payment gateway integrations like PayPal, Stripe, and bKash.

Subscriber Management: Automates user renewals, data volume quotas (FUP), and session limits. Risks of Using "Nulled" Versions
